Transaction 335a2b48b93cd5f6945c64faa4cb186ae3130efa225ab43b27571332011aaceb

1 Input
1 Outputs
  • 335a2b48b93cd5f6945c64faa4cb186ae3130efa225ab43b27571332011aaceb:0
  • value  7602105
    address  1CuruxDcH4K6WYrqAizAcbqxw6hwVVZYY4